Build Quality
The KastKing combo boasts a lightweight IM6 graphite construction, designed for durability and sensitivity, featuring aluminum oxide ringed stainless steel guides. This makes it an excellent choice for anglers who prioritize performance and long-lasting use. On the other hand, the Kids Fishing Pole Kit is made from glass fiber, which, while still strong and durable, is tailored for children and offers less sensitivity compared to the KastKing. Each product’s build quality reflects its intended use; the KastKing is built for performance, while the Kids kit ensures safety and ease of use for young anglers.
Features and Functionality
The KastKing Brent Chapman Combo includes features that enhance its performance, such as a 5+1 bearing system and a 7.1:1 gear ratio for smooth retrieval. It also comes pre-spooled with line, allowing users to fish immediately without additional setup. Conversely, the Kids Fishing Pole Kit includes a telescopic rod that collapses to a compact size for easy storage, along with a simple closed-face reel for hassle-free casting. The inclusion of 64 colorful lures and hooks adds value and fun for children, making their first fishing experience enjoyable. Each product is equipped with features that cater to its specific audience, enhancing overall user experience.
Portability and Storage
Portability is a significant factor for both products, but they approach it differently. The Kids Fishing Pole Kit is designed to be lightweight and collapsible, measuring just 13.7 inches when retracted, making it easy for children to carry and store. This is ideal for family outings or vacations. On the other hand, while the KastKing combo is also relatively portable due to its two-piece rod design, it is primarily focused on performance rather than compactness. Both products offer practical solutions for transport, but the Kids Fishing Pole Kit excels in convenience for travel.

Ease of Use
Ease of use is a critical consideration for both products, but they cater to different users. The KastKing Brent Chapman Combo, although designed for more experienced anglers, comes pre-spooled for immediate fishing, which is a significant convenience. Its advanced features, however, may require some understanding of baitcasting techniques. In contrast, the Kids Fishing Pole Kit features a push-button design that allows children to cast with minimal effort, making it exceptionally user-friendly. This focus on simplicity ensures that young users can learn and enjoy fishing without feeling overwhelmed, making it the better option for beginners.
